Casio SK-5 “Synapse k-5”
This is probably about my 6th build, but my 1st serious one. Basically I spent a couple days poking around, playing with different things finding nice groans, crackles, glitches etc. Really u can go on forever with all the different combinations of bends but I decided to keep it simple but approach it like a synth style. It has 22 spdt toggle switches wired in, 17 of which can be viewed as 3 basic groups. The other 5 switches control speaker on/off, internal LED’s and body contact on/off. below is a list of mods on it.


11 key effect switches
3 effect adjustment potentiometers
2 triggers/threshhold switches
5 drum effect switches
8 body contacts
1 RCA duo effect Break-out Box
1 1/4in. output
